"Justice demands courage," Blanche wrote in his announcement on X, adding, "I intend to meet with [Maxwell] soon. No one is above the law — and no lead is off-limits."

This move may have been intended to quell the rising anger from Trump's own base that the DOJ has been unable to deliver on their promise of turning over all files on the Epstein case, including the rumored "client list" of wealthy and powerful people who indulged in Epstein's dark acts with him — which has no evidence of existing and which the DOJ has stated does not exist, but which has persisted in the narrative of conspiracy theorists on both the left and right for years.
But the timing of the announcement, coupled with longstanding knowledge that Trump himself used to be friends with Epstein, has spurred a more sinister theory from some political and legal observers on social media: that administration officials are moving to secure Maxwell's silence, or maybe even offer her a presidential pardon, something Trump biographer Michael Wolff alleged he has considered in the past.

The meeting itself is considered unusual, as it is rare for a convicted sex trafficker to meet with a high-ranking Justice Department official, especially one who previously served as the President's personal lawyer. Blanche's meetings with Maxwell are seen as an attempt to address the ongoing controversy surrounding the Epstein case and the administration's handling of related documents. It's notable that Blanche, who was confirmed as Deputy AG in March 2025, served as President Donald Trump's criminal defense attorney in several cases, including the New York hush money trial.
